Injured spinner Kerrigan misses Glamorgan clash as Northants make two changes

Left-arm spinner Simon Kerrigan will miss Northants' LV= Insurance County Championship clash with Glamorgan through injury.

Kerrigan picked up a side strain in the defeat at his former club Lancashire last weekend, and misses out in the four-day clash which starts at Wantage Road on Thursday.

Also missing against the Welsh county is seam bowling all-roudner Tom Taylor, which means the County will be without the bowlers who claimed nine wickets between them at Old Trafford.

Coming into the 13 to face Glamorgan are batsman Charlie Thurston, who missed the Lancashire match with a back strain, and pace bowler Jack White.

Overseas signing Wayne Parnell is also included and is in line to make his debut for the club.

Former skipper Alex Wakely, who missed the trip to Old Trafford for personal reasons, is still absent.

Glamorgan coach Matt Maynard has also named a 13-man squad for the trip to Northampton.

Included is new signing James Harris, who has joined the club on a two-week loan from Middlesex.

Timm van der Gugten has been rested, while in the other change to the squad that lost to Sussex last weekend, Joe Cooke replaces Tom Cullen.

Northamptonshire squad to face Glamorgan: Gareth Berg, Nathan Buck, Ben Curran, Emilio Gay, Rob Keogh, Wayne Parnell, Luke Procter, Adam Rossington, Ben Sanderson, Charlie Thurston, Ricardo Vasconcelos, Jack White, Saif Zaib

Glamorgan squad: Chris Cooke, Andy Balbirnie, Kiran Carlson, Joe Cooke, Dan Douthwaite, James Harris, Michael Hogan, David Lloyd, Billy Root, Nick Selman, Callum Taylor, Roman Walker, James Weighell
